How they compare

Cook Islands currently reports 34.66 t against 31.65 t in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 3.01 t.

That makes Cook Islands's figure about 1.1 times Saint Kitts and Nevis's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.

Cook Islands ranks 111th and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 112th of 186 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Cook Islands averaged higher in 3 and Saint Kitts and Nevis in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Cook Islands Saint Kitts and Nevis Difference Ahead
1960s -80.5 t 361.11 t 441.61 t Saint Kitts and Nevis
1970s -78.4 t 1,236 t 1,315 t Saint Kitts and Nevis
1980s -95.33 t 608.97 t 704.29 t Saint Kitts and Nevis
1990s -76.06 t 37.96 t 114.02 t Saint Kitts and Nevis
2000s 41.43 t 20.04 t 21.4 t Cook Islands
2010s 82.45 t 64.09 t 18.36 t Cook Islands
2020s 43.48 t 28.39 t 15.09 t Cook Islands

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
